Pepper&Carrot è una serie di webcomic open source dell'artista francese David Revoy. La serie è composta da piccoli episodi sulla strega adolescente Pepper e il suo gatto Carrot. Con le sue traduzioni in 28 lingue diverse e storie senza violenza mira ad essere accessibile a tutti.
David Revoy crea la serie interamente con software gratuiti, come Krita e Inkscape, rendendo disponibili per il download i file sorgente Krita per ogni immagine. Tutte le opere d'arte sono rese disponibili sotto la licenza Creative Commons Attribution 4.0. Incoraggia esplicitamente la fanart e altri lavori derivati.
